## Ownership

The garage occupancy feed (Stallwatch) publishes per-level counts every 30 seconds from the sensor gateway. It's read-only downstream, but the ingest side touches building-network credentials, so treat changes here as security-sensitive. If you spot anything sketchy during review, don't just file it and hope — flag it directly to the person responsible, listed below.

named custodian: Brivan Eliath Quenox Frador

# ORM Refactor: Limits and Quotas

This page tracks the quotas governing the phased refactor of the Bramblevault legacy ORM layer. Each migration batch converts a bounded number of entity mappings so reviewers can diff the generated SQL without drowning. Connection pool ceilings stay fixed during the transition; we'd rather queue than let the old and new mappers compete for sockets. Reviewers should reject any patch that raises these caps without a benchmark attached. The constants currently in force are shown below.

tuning constants:
QUOTAS = {
    "druwyn": 5,
    "holix": 5,
    "zorath": 5,
    "holwyn": 10,
}

Subject: Handover — Corvel planner regression

Taking time off Friday. The query planner regression in Corvel 6.1 is patched in 6.1.3; rollout is at 40%, finish it Monday. Watch p99 on the analytics shard. Rollback tag is prepped if needed. Sign the final promotion with the deploy key below.

signing key of bagap-yawep = bky13_TbfT6ZMUoGJo2